**About Our Client**:
Page Personnel has partnered with a Work Health and Safety On-site provider that support remote mining, racecourses and construction businesses with on-site medical, emergency response, risk management training and occupational health support services.

The key duties of this role are,
- Onboard new employees ensuring all relevant documentation, inductions, training and medicals are completed
- To coordinate mobilisation of employees including arranging travel and accommodation
- To contribute as a team member to successful company performance through achievement of individual Key Performance Indicators.
- To assist Baseline Group achieve their financial, business and unit targets and objectives.

Taking into consideration the scope of the role, additional work hours may be required from time to time depending on the operational demands of the business. Due to the nature of the role, the Mobilisation Coordinator is expected to be in the office during the business hours of 0800-16:00 with some flexibility.The Mobilisation Coordinator has the authority to:

- Book Medicals
- Organise Inductions (with no cost)
- Book Hire Vehicles
- Prepare contracts for site based employees (Manager to approve)

**The Successful Applicant**:

- Experience or demonstrated ability in the mobilisation field.
- Strong Microsoft Office skills, especially in Word and Excel.
- Demonstrated skills in planning and organising mobilisation activities, including self-prioritisation skills to ensure workload is managed effectively within agreed time frames and deadlines.
- Demonstrated well-developed communication and interpersonal skills, both written and verbal skills especially when dealing with key stakeholders. Personal Competency
- An ability to be flexible, to adapt to changing deadlines and business demands, with an ability to grow with the business.
- An ability to demonstrate tact and diplomacy when dealing with sensitive situations, maintaining confidentiality.
- An ability to work effectively, as part of a team to ensure team and business goals are met effectively and efficiently.
- Ability to learn quickly and work in a fast paced environment.
- High attention to detail and maintaining integrity. Experience / Qualifications
- Minimum 2 years mobilisation experience in a similar role.
- Experience in the Health/Mining industry is highly desirable.
